Research Specialist at the Thompson-Schill Lab (Computational Neuroscience Initiative, University of Pennsylvania)
The Thompson-Schill Lab, in the Department of Psychology, seeks a Research Specialist to assist Dr. Sharon Thompson-Schill and other lab members in a variety of administrative tasks. The Research Specialist will have the opportunity to conduct independent and supervised research projects in service of the lab’s funded research topics relating to memory, learning, cognitive control, and language. Specifically, this involves designing psychology experiments (methods include fMRI, TMS, EEG, and eye-tracking), recruiting and running subjects, analyzing data, and presenting research. Position also requires successful candidate to draft, modify, and renew IRB documents; coordinate lab finances; register attendees for research conferences; purchase supplies and software licenses; and complete other administrative tasks as assigned.
